Randomly generated purple pegs act as score multipliers, while hitting a green peg enables your Peggle Master’s power. Your main goal is to use your allotment of balls to hit all of the orange pegs found scattered amid a sea of blue pegs. The boards, pegs and objectives, meanwhile, will prove familiar to anyone who played the first game.
